Orthodontic Insurance Coverage Options
To better manage the expenses of orthodontic therapy, check out available orthodontic insurance coverage choices to possibly offset expenses. Many oral insurance strategies use orthodontic coverage, which can help in reducing the out-of-pocket expenses connected with braces or Invisalign therapy. It's essential to evaluate your insurance policy meticulously to recognize the extent of the insurance coverage attended to orthodontic treatments. Some insurance policy strategies may cover a percentage of the therapy price, while others might offer a fixed quantity. Additionally, there might be limitations on the kind of orthodontic treatment covered or the age at which insurance coverage applies.
Prior to starting your orthodontic treatment, call your insurance policy company to ask about the certain details of your insurance coverage. Recognizing your insurance advantages can help you prepare financially for your orthodontic care and maximize the protection readily available to you. Bear in mind that deductibles, co-pays, and yearly maximums may use, so it's critical to be familiar with these factors when budgeting for your treatment. Flexible Investing Accounts (FSAs) for Orthodontics
Explore how Flexible Investing Accounts (FSAs) can be made use of to cover orthodontic costs and maximize your financial savings on therapy expenses. FSAs are a useful tool that allows you to allot pre-tax money from your paycheck to cover certified clinical costs, consisting of orthodontic therapies. Below are some bottom lines to take into consideration when using FSAs for orthodontics:
- ** Tax Financial Savings **: Contributions to FSAs are made pre-tax, decreasing your taxable income and giving potential savings on orthodontic therapy costs.
- ** Budgeting **: FSAs enable you to budget for orthodontic costs by spreading the expense throughout the years with routine contributions from your income.
- ** Maximum Payment Limitations **: Recognize the annual contribution restrictions set by the internal revenue service for FSAs to ensure you maximize your savings successfully.
- ** Certified Expenses **: Guarantee that your orthodontic therapy is a qualified expense under your FSA plan to stay clear of any kind of issues with compensation.
